Vocation Videos coming on DVD!
09.17.2007

Youth ministry media providers Outside da Box announced they will be packaging Sarah Bauer`s online video series "4 Days : 4 Videos : 4 Vocations" on DVD as the featured material of their next edition, entitled Vocare.

Eric Groth, president of Outside da Box, comments, "After meeting with Sarah last winter we were planning to do a music video for one of the songs on her new album. She shared about the inspiration and meaning of the song `Radiance`, and we realized including the video series was a perfect, and providential, fit."

Sarah shares, "I have gotten dozens and dozens of e-mails and phone calls from youth ministers, schools and vocations directors asking how they could get a copy of the video series on DVD to spread the message. I didn`t know where to begin to make something like that happen, so I started praying about it. When I talked with Eric about the music video, the idea just seemed to click!" Bauer also believes the distribution of these videos serves a higher purpose. "Right from the beginning of this series, I felt the Holy Spirit in such a profound way. I prayed that it would reach everyone that it is supposed to. With the huge distribution that Outside da Box has, its reach will be far more than I ever thought possible."

The DVD will also feature the official music video for "Radiance", which was produced by Outside da Box.

"Radiance" Online Launch!
08.28.2007

With over two years in the making, Sarah Bauer`s newest album, Radiance, hits the streets today. This follow-up to the critically acclaimed Lead Me Home in 2005, once again promises to deliver Sarah`s signature: Real Woman, Real Faith, Real Rock.

When asked about the new album, Sarah spoke, "It`s definitely my favorite album so far, digging much deeper lyrically and writing melodies to support their depth." She continues, "Its message is the most important to date, too. This past year, God has really shown me what it means to shine your own unique light, and I wanted to convey that message as encouragement all throughout the album."

The album was recorded in Nashville, TN under the production of Todd Robbins, whose work with artists such as dc talk, Michael W. Smith, and Jaci Velasquez, have earned two Grammies and over a dozen gold and platinum albums. Bauer remarks, "I am so humbled to have had the opportunity to work with Todd. I had a specific sound I was going for with this album: super fun, a little aggressive at times, but still really letting the vocals and lyrics drive the songs. I really had no idea what more I could say to convey the sounds in my head, but he totally nailed it. It sounds incredible, way better than I ever could have imagined."

Sarah Wins at International Songwriting Competition
07.17.2007

National Christian recording artist Sarah Bauer takes home the second place award from Faith Hope and Love International`s 2007 Songwriting Invitational. The invitational was part of FHL`s community service week in Indianapolis.

Bauer submitted two songs from her new album, "My Own Backyard" and "Radiance". Winning the hearts of the panel of judges, her two recordings took the top two spots out of over 100 songs submitted. The songs were judged by originality, lyrical content, and musicianship. "I selected those two songs, because I felt they best represented the FHL organization: shining your presence by serving in the local community."

After the preliminary round of judging, Bauer and three other finalists performed at the two largest venues in Indianapolis: Conseco Fieldhouse and outdoors at Monument Circle. In a tight vote via an "applause meter", Bauer was awarded second place.

"I was just happy to be able to come together with other artists to support a great organization and the local community," commented Bauer.
